Nick Saban: A Brief Biography

Nick Saban, born in Fairmont, West Virginia, has truly carved out a unique place in football history. His coaching career spans decades, beginning with various assistant roles before he took on head coaching positions. He had stints with teams like Toledo, Michigan State, and LSU, where he actually won a national championship. Then, of course, came his time with the Miami Dolphins in the NFL, which was a bit of a shorter stay.

His move to the University of Alabama in 2007, however, really changed everything for him and the program. Over 17 seasons, he led the Crimson Tide to six national championships, creating what many call a dynasty. This incredible run of success, naturally, made him one of the most celebrated and highly compensated coaches in any sport. His recent retirement in January 2024 certainly marked the end of a truly remarkable era.

The Power of Coaching Contracts: Salary & Bonuses

When people ask 'what is Nick Saban net worth', a huge part of the answer lies in his coaching contracts. For years, he was consistently the highest-paid coach in college football, or very nearly so. His base salary alone was quite substantial, but that was just one piece of the puzzle. His deals often included significant bonuses for achievements like winning conference titles or, naturally, national championships.

His final contract with Alabama, signed in 2022, was reportedly worth around $93.6 million over eight years. That averaged out to roughly $11.7 million per year, which is a pretty staggering figure. These contracts weren't just about the annual pay; they also often included perks like private jet usage, housing allowances, and even retention bonuses designed to keep him with the program. Such agreements are, in a way, complex financial arrangements.

For instance, his 2022 deal included an annual base salary of $305,000, but a huge "talent fee" made up the bulk of his compensation. This structure is fairly typical for top-tier coaches, allowing universities to offer competitive packages while managing different budget lines. The longevity of his career at the highest level, too, meant he benefited from escalating salaries over time, reflecting his sustained success and market value. This is how, over many years, the numbers really add up.

Endorsements and Sponsorship Deals

Beyond his coaching salary, a significant portion of Nick Saban's wealth comes from various endorsement and sponsorship deals. His image and reputation as a winner made him a very attractive figure for many brands. These partnerships range across different industries, from automotive to financial services. So, you might have seen him in commercials for a variety of products.

For example, he had a long-standing partnership with Mercedes-Benz, appearing in local and regional advertisements. These deals aren't just about the money; they also help maintain his public profile and connect him with a broader audience. Other notable endorsements have included companies like Aflac, a well-known insurance provider, where he appeared alongside Deion Sanders in some pretty memorable ads. These types of agreements, naturally, add a good chunk to his yearly earnings.

The value of these endorsements can vary widely, but for someone of Saban's stature, they often run into the millions of dollars annually.
